Now read on a bit more for supplemental details to do with these topics. Cotton is one of the most common options for garments since it's very lightweight and comfortable. Regular cotton, though, is not normally produced in an environmentally friendly way because of it being an agricultural product. Cultivating cotton requires fertilizers, which is not environmentally friendly. A further environmental concern is the utilization of damaging insecticide. If you are on the market for goods that have been traded fairly then cotton will usually not fall into that category. If you ask if the cotton has been organically farmed then you may be able to find items that are earth friendly. If you ask, you should be able to estimate if a retail shop does sell goods and particularly cotton that is earth friendly. As used in lots of fine clothing, wool is associated with providing a feeling of comfort. Wool is used in a lot of apparel whether it be socks or a hat and scarf. Naturally, wool comes from animals so it's earth friendly; still, you need to make sure. Organic wool in essence means that the sheep will have been eating organic food. In addition, we may inquire if the sheep have been grown in a good means. Sheep that are allowed to roam free and consume grass are regarded to be brought up humanely and naturally; nevertheless their wool will be more expensive.
